Olivia Rose Austin roses are part of a type of English rose shrub bred by David Austin, a family farm in Shropshire that carries out most of its rose growing by hand. According to its website, this certain type of rose shrub has "pretty buds [that] open to beautiful, cupped rosettes of an even, mid pink colouring."
